Date:  12-18-2021
Number of Hours:  2.00
Manual Reference:  28iS/U-02-03
Brief Description:  Rudder Pedals

Cut the F-1235A Inboard Rudder Pedal Block and the two F-1235B Outboard Rudder Pedal Blocks per figure 1 page 28iS/U-02 and marked the split parts for reassembly. Clamped the WD-01206-1 Rudder Pedals using the F-1235A & B Rudder Pedal Blocks as shown in Figure 2 same page after installing the AN3-22A and washers and bolts temporarily to hold. Slid the WD-1211-L & -R Brake Pedal Torque Tubes into the WD-01206-1 Rudder Pedals per figure 3 same page. With the F-1235A & B Rudder Pedal Blocks flush against the work surface, locked the neutral position by inserting a WD-1211-L Brake Pedal Torque into both the WD-01206-1 Rudder Pedals per figure 3. Temporarily attached the BRAKE MAST.CYL.RIGHT-1 & LEFT-1 to the WD-01206-1 Rudder Pedals and WD-1211-L & -R Brake Pedal Torque Tubes per figure 4 same page. Slide the WD-1209 Brake Pedals over the WD-1211-L & -R Brake Pedal Torque Tubes and against the WD-01206-1 Rudder Pedals per figure 4. Used a square and level to make sure the WD-1209 were vertical then clamped the brake pedals to the rudder pedals per same figure. Match drilled #30 the 1/8 hole in one side of the brake pedals into the underlying WD-1211-L & -R Brake Pedal Torque Tubes. Cleco'ed then match drilled the other side. Drilled #12 all the way through the holes in both sides of the WD-1209 Brake Pedals and WD-1211-L & -R Brake Pedal Torque Tubs, then final drilled all the way through 1/4. Marked all parts for reassembly, disassembled and deburred then repeated the process of match drilling and final drilling for the other end of the WD-012106-1 Rudder Pedals per figure 2 page 28iS/U-03.
